When different fabrics are tumbling against each other in the dryer, it creates static that makes your clothes cling together. Let’s start with the basics: Dryer sheets are small slips made of polyester fibers coated with a blend of fabric softener, fragrance, and lubricants. Some sheets are made of natural or cellulose fibers that can be recycled. Yes, dryer sheets can eliminate excess static cling, but they're far more interesting than that.
